How far is Dingley Village from Melbourne’s Central Business District?

Dingley Village lies about 23 km south‑east of Melbourne’s CBD.

Can you share a brief history of Dingley Village?

Originally called Dingley, the area was renamed Dingley Village in 1991; it began as a 19th‑century farming community, grew a cannery in the 1920s, and experienced major urbanisation from the 1960s onward.
